Google's Android operating system for smartphones has seen dramatic growth in Europe, where it now ranks as the second most popular smartphone OS on the continent, according to the latest numbers from ComScore. Symbian still leads the pack, but Android blew past the iPhone to grab 22.3% of the market...

NFC, short for near field communications, is a short-range wireless technology that's forming the backbone of new mobile payments and mobile wallet services like Google Wallet or Visa's digital wallet. With an NFC phone, you can pay for purchases at any contactless payments-enabled point-of-sale location with just a tap or...

Isis, the NFC-enabled mobile payments venture led by three of the four major U.S. operators, AT&T, Verizon and T-Mobile, has changed its course. Originally, the service was designed so that the operators themselves would take a cut of every mobile transaction made, with customers maintaining accounts with the carrier. Now,...
